Jabin Grubbs


(From Derfelt Funeral Home)

It is with great sadness and a heavy heart that the family announces the passing of Jabin Edward Grubbs, age 45, of Quapaw, OK. Jabin passed away peacefully on Sunday, April 2, 2023 at Freeman Hospital in Joplin, MO surrounded by his loving family.

He was born on August 18, 1977, in Los Angeles, CA to Larry Grubbs and the late Stephanie Anderson Grubbs. After graduating from Dierks High School he then went on to attend college at Missouri Southern State University and was currently working as a forklift operator for CNC Manufacturing in Joplin, MO.







Jabin, who was taken home way too soon, had such a kind and thoughtful soul and will be missed by many. When he was young, he loved playing football in high school and everyone knew him for his generosity and friendly personality. He was blessed with the gift of being able to talk to anyone no matter where he was at, was full of stories to share with anyone willing to listen, and could make anyone in the room laugh. 

Jabin has always had a strong work ethic even at a young age and loved to spend his free time fishing and with his family. But his true passion in life though was watching his son, Keegan, play football. It meant everything in the world to him to be cheering him on from the sidelines at every game.








Jabin is survived by his spouse, Kristy Niday, of the home; one son, Keegan Hart of the home; two daughters, Torye Hart and finance, Juston of Columbus, KS and Kyliegh Grubbs; father, Larry Grubbs and wife, Benda of Columbus, KS; two brothers, Justice Grubbs and wife, Becca of Joplin, MO and Jonas Grubbs of Tulsa, OK; two sisters, Genevive Tullis and husband, Joel of Carl Junction, MO and Carissa Loomis and spouse, Tyler of Joplin, MO and lots of nieces and nephews.

Funeral services will be 1:00 p.m., Thursday, April 6, 2023, at the Derfelt Funeral Home, Baxter Chapel. The family will receive friends on Wednesday from 5:00 p.m. until 7:00 p.m. at the funeral home. Burial will be in the G.A.R. cemetery, Miami, OK.

Funeral services are under the direction of the Derfelt Funeral Home, Baxter Chapel.
